In the given figure, three sectors of a circle of radius 7 cm, making angle sof `60^(@), 80^(@)` and `40^(@)` at the centre are shaded. Find the area of the shaded region.

A

`57cm^(2)`

B

`77cm^(2)`

C

`71cm^(2)`

D

None

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

Required area `={pixx7^(2)xx((60^(@)+80^(@)xx40^(@))/(360^(@)))}cm^(2)`
`=(22/7xx49xx180/360)=77cm^(2)`
